Strategic Plan

Strategy Plan for 51ÉçÇø 2025-2030

This strategic plan positions 51ÉçÇø for longterm success by focusing on innovation and excellence in education. Through these four strategic goals, we will create a more engaging learning environment, expand access to education, enrich campus life, and ensure operational efficiency, ultimately empowering our students and strengthening our community.

Mission Statement

51ÉçÇø is committed to improving the lives of those in our communities by providing quality education, outstanding service, and relevant industry training.

Vision Statement

51ÉçÇø will be a leading community college and the local gateway to higher education and training by providing innovative and creative opportunities to learn, grow, and achieve with a focus on equitable
educational opportunities, students and their success, and a commitment to communities and their development.

Stakeholders

51ÉçÇøâ€™s stakeholders are those on whom the success or failure of the institution depend. Students, parents of students, employees, legislators, feeder schools, industry partners, the general population, and other two- and four-year universities represent the stakeholders.

2030 Strategic Objectives

IMPROVE THE QUALITY, ACCESSIBILITY, AND RELEVANCE OF EDUCATIONAL SERVICES TO SUPPORT STUDENT SUCCESS.

  • Align curricula, credentials, certificates, and degrees
    with transfer, career, and entrepreneurial opportunities.
  • Promote civic, community, and global engagement, with
    opportunities for students, faculty and staff to participate
    in volunteer work and community organizations.
  • Promote faculty professional development to improve
    teaching practices, including strategies to enhance class
    participation, integrate technology, and enhance
    educational assessment.
  • Offer flexible and innovative scheduling to help learners
    balance life and education.
  • Increase real-world learning opportunities through
    internships, apprenticeships, and shadowing programs.
    Use data-driven assessment to continuously improve
    learning outcomes.

IMPROVE INSTITUTIONAL EFFECTIVENESS, ACCOUNTABILITY, AND SUSTAINABILITY THROUGH EFFICIENT OPERATIONS AND
DATA-DRIVEN DECISIONS.

  • Build relationships, expand partnerships, and develop pipeline programs with schools, community organizations, and businesses.
  • Increase affordability and financial resources to alleviate financial challenges for students.
  • Promote academic success and reduce barriers through personalized advising, mentorships, tutoring, and support services.

CREATE A WELCOMING, SAFE, AND VIBRANT CAMPUS ENVIRONMENT.

  • Develop a plan to modernize classrooms, labs, dining areas, and communal spaces to foster belonging.
  • Implement advanced security systems and mental health resources for students and staff.
  • Expand extracurricular and student organization programs for enhanced collaboration and learning.
  • Strengthen student-athlete support systems to
    balance academics and sports.

IMPROVE INSTITUTIONAL EFFECTIVENESS, ACCOUNTABILITY, AND SUSTAINABILITY THROUGH EFFICIENT OPERATIONS AND
DATA-DRIVEN DECISIONS.

  • Utilize data analytics to track performance and support
    strategic planning.
  • Streamline policies and processes to increase
    efficiency.
  • Develop a proactive fiscal strategy that aligns revenue
    growth with program and staffing priorities.
  • Invest in modern digital infrastructure and cybersecurity
    to support learning and operations.
  • Strengthen employee recruitment, retention, and
    succession planning.
  • Foster a culture of employee engagement through open
    communication and collaboration.
  • Promote eco-friendly practices, including waste reduction
    and energy-efficient technologies.
